    Question to Radio Yerevan: "Is it true that comrade cosmonaut Gagarin won a car at a charity banquet in Moscow?"


    Radio Erivan answers: "In principle yes. Yet we have to point out that it was not the cosmonaut Gagarin, but the teacher Gagarin. Furthermore, it was not in Moscow but in Kiev, and it did not happen at a charity banquet but at a party congress. Finally, it was not a car that he won, but a bicycle that was stolen from him.”

    -------------------
    Question to Radio Yerevan: "Is there a difference between capitalism and communism?

    Radio Yerevan answers: "In principle, yes. In capitalism, man exploits man. In communism, it's the reverse."

    -------------------
    Question to Radio Yerevan: “I have heard that Americans can publicly criticise the American president. Do people have that kind of freedom in the Soviet Union?”


    Radio Yerevan answers: “Of course they do. Anybody in the Soviet Union is totally free to criticise the American president.”

    -------------------
    Question to Radio Yerevan: “Is it true that in the Soviet Union people do not need stereophonic equipment?"

    Radio Yerevan answers: “In principle, yes. One hears exactly the same thing from all sides."
